AC-Motor (SolidWorks 2015 Tutorial)

In this SolidWorks tutorial, we have created a model named ‘AC-Motor’. This assembly consists of two parts one is motor and second is the motor shaft. AC-Motor is a Subassembly of ‘Blower’. The Design of ‘AC-Motor’ has been taken from Assembly of 'Blower' → ‘Sample files’ → Autodesk Inventor.

In this SolidWorks tutorial, we will describe how to build the model of ‘AC-Motor’. It will cover the following topics. • Creating 2D Sketches on different Planes of the model. • Use the sketch constraints with the aid of ‘Add/Relation’ tool that is applied on during sketch creation. • Use feature commands such as Revolved Boss/Base, Extruded Boss/Base, Extruded Cut, Circular Pattern, Linear Pattern, Mirror, Chamfer and the Fillet tool. • Adds the Extruded Cut feature to create a hole on the face of the model. • Use the Circular Pattern and Linear Pattern tool to create multiple instances of one feature.
